Splet21. nov. 2016 · Both phonon and photon generated carriers contribute to leakage current. Look up the derivation of the ideal diode equation. Forward bias current is due to diffusion, the exponential term. Reverse bias current , the constant term, is due to drift of generated carriers by the built in field of the junction.
